Abstract
Electrodynamics model of calculation of waveguide junctions with anisotropic filling have been developed. This model is intended to determine electric properties of crystalline dielectrics in the microwave region. The conditions, on which common wave equation for hybrid waves breaks up in two equations, were found. Their two solutions correspond to H- and E- modes. The SLAE for H-modes includes only component epsiv z of dielectric permittivity tensor epsiv circ and that for E-modes includes components epsiv x and epsiv y . This allows one to determine the influence of each component of tensor epsiv circ on various modes separately. Using designed numerical algorithms and program software, the analysis has been carried out and the dependence of resonant frequencies on geometric size of structure and the filling material parameters, which are of practical interest (eigen H- and E- modes), have been received. Numerical data, owing to which the ends of waveguides are practically non-radiating, are shown. Obtained results allow us to use waveguide junctions for nondestructive measurement of characteristic of filling substances.
